5 Surprising Benefits of Drinking Herbal Teas 5 Surprising Benefits of Drinking Herbal Teas Herbal teas have been enjoyed for centuries, not just for their delightful flavors but also for their many health benefits. Here are five surprising reasons you should consider adding herbal tea to your daily routine! 1. Boosts Immunity Herbal teas, like echinacea and elderberry, are known for their ability to help boost your immune system. Drinking a cup of these teas regularly can reduce the severity and duration of colds, helping you stay healthier throughout the year. 2. Supports Digestion Herbal teas such as peppermint, ginger, and chamomile are known for their digestive properties. Understanding Dietary Fats: A Quick Overview Fats are an essential part of a balanced diet, playing important roles in energy production, hormone regulation, and nutrient absorption. However, it's crucial to know which types of fats to include and which to limit in your diet. Let’s break it down: Unsaturated Fats: Found in foods like avocados, olive oil, nuts, and seeds.
